Understanding Tether: A Stablecoin Powerhouse

Tether (USDT) is a leading name in the world of stablecoins, a class of cryptocurrency designed to facilitate transactions by maintaining a stable value. Unlike volatile c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in or Ethereum, stablecoins like Tether aim to provide users with the stability of fiat currency, while still leveraging the benefits of blockchain technology.

The Mechanism Behind Tether's Stability

Tether achieves its stability by pegging its value to traditional fiat currencies, primarily the U.S. Dollar. Each Tether token is reportedly backed by an equivalent amount of fiat currency held in reserve. This 1:1 backing mechanism is key to maintaining the coin's stable value, as reflected in its market price which typically hovers around 1 USD.

Historical Development and Milestones

Tether's inception dates back to 2014, and since then, it has played a pivotal role in demonstrating the practical use case of stablecoins within the crypto ecosystem. Its journey has seen significant milestones, including reaching its all-time high of $1.32 in July 2018, and experiencing its low at $0.572521 in March 2015. These deviations, while noteworthy, are rare occurrences in Tether's overall history, underscoring its primary objective of price stability.

Advantages of Using Tether

The primary advantage of Tether is its stability, making it a safe harbor for investors during times of high volatility in the broader cryptocurrency market. By offering price predictability, it facilitates more efficient trading, lending, and arbitrage, making it an indispensable tool for crypto exchanges and users alike. Moreover, Tether's utility is further enhanced by its widespread acceptance and high liquidity.

Challenges and Controversies

Despite its widespread use, Tether has faced scrutiny regarding its claims of full fiat backing. Critics have raised concerns about transparency, regulatory challenges, and the adequacy of its audited reserves. These issues have occasionally prompted regulatory attention and calls for greater transparency and accountability from Tether’s management.

Terra Luna Classic

Introduction to Terra Luna Classic

Terra Luna Classic, often referred to simply as "LUNC," has been a significant player in the world of cryptocurrencies. As a version of Terra that predates various forks and updates, Luna Classic represents an interesting case study of what happens when a blockchain network undergoes substantial changes. In this article, we’ll explore its history, current status, and future potential.

A Brief History of Terra Luna Classic

Originally, Terra Luna was launched as a major protocol aiming to combine the price stability and wide adoption of fiat currencies with the censorship-resistance characteristic of cryptocurrencies. This was achieved through an algorithmic stablecoin model. However, an eventful day in May 2022, marked by the all-time high just a month earlier, saw LUNC plummeting to significant lows.

The crash, often attributed to flaws in the algorithmic model and external market pressures, forced the Terra community to re-evaluate and restructure, leading to a division between newer iterations of the network and the "Classic" version that persisted. As of now, the community maintains support for LUNC, allowing it to survive in niche market roles.

The Pros and Cons of Terra Luna Classic

Advantages

One of the key advantages of Terra Luna Classic is its established community. Despite the hardships faced in 2022, a core group of developers and investors remains committed, ensuring continuous development and updates.

Additionally, LUNC’s price recovery from the same year’s low speaks to its resilience. The coin has experienced substantial growth in percentage terms from its all-time low, regaining some investor confidence.

Challenges

However, Terra Luna Classic also faces substantial challenges. Chief amongst them is the loss in trust experienced by many investors and traders during the crash. This has impacted its market cap significantly, a factor further compounded by robust competition from other stablecoin and DeFi projects.

Moreover, the crypto’s technical model required significant re-evaluation, as purely algorithmic stable coins, such as the one Terra initially planned, have now fallen under suspicion. The necessity for new models or hybrid approaches is evident.
